Loan Options and Strategies to Manage Student Debt

Federal Student Loans

Federal student loans are typically the first and most accessible source of funding for undergraduate students. For students attending UC Davis, the Federal Direct Loan Program offers Direct Subsidized Loans for undergraduate students with financial need, and Direct Unsubsidized Loans for all eligible students, regardless of need. These loans feature fixed interest rates, flexible repayment plans, and borrower protections such as income-driven repayment options.

Private Student Loans

Private loans are offered by banks, credit unions, and other financial institutions. They may be necessary if federal aid does not cover the full cost of education, especially for out-of-state students or those seeking additional funding. Private loans often have higher interest rates and less flexible repayment options. It is advisable to exhaust federal aid options before considering private loans.

Strategies for Managing Student Debt

Effective debt management begins with borrowing responsibly. Students should only take out loans necessary to cover tuition, fees, and essential living expenses. Creating a budget to understand monthly expenses and income can help avoid unnecessary borrowing. Additionally, exploring scholarships, work-study programs, and part-time employment can reduce reliance on loans. After graduation, selecting income-driven repayment plans and considering loan forgiveness programs can ease repayment burdens.

Program Overview and What Students Will Study

Introduction to Chemical Engineering

The Bachelor of Science in Chemical Engineering at UC Davis prepares students to solve complex problems in industries such as pharmaceuticals, energy, food, and environmental sectors. The program combines foundational sciences with engineering principles, emphasizing practical applications and research.

Curriculum Highlights

Students will study core courses in chemistry, physics, mathematics, and biology, alongside specialized chemical engineering topics such as thermodynamics, fluid mechanics, process design, reaction engineering, and materials science. Laboratory work, design projects, and internships are integral parts of the curriculum, fostering hands-on experience.

Capstone and Research Opportunities

The program offers capstone projects that simulate real-world engineering challenges, encouraging teamwork and innovation. Students also have opportunities to engage in research with faculty, contributing to advancements in sustainable energy, environmental protection, and bioprocessing.

Career Opportunities and Job Prospects

Industry Sectors

Graduates with a degree in Chemical Engineering from UC Davis are well-positioned for careers in various sectors, including petrochemicals, pharmaceuticals, food processing, environmental management, and renewable energy. The versatile skill set acquired allows for roles in process engineering, product development, research, and management.

Job Outlook and Salary Expectations

The job market for chemical engineers remains robust, with an expected growth rate aligned with national averages. Entry-level salaries typically range from $70,000 to $90,000 annually, with experienced professionals earning well above this range. The median salary varies depending on location, industry, and experience.

Advanced Education and Certifications

Many graduates pursue master’s or doctoral degrees for specialization, research roles, or academia. Certifications such as Professional Engineer (PE) license can enhance career advancement and earning potential.

Financial Information: Tuition, Debt, and Return on Investment

Tuition Costs

For in-state students, the annual tuition is approximately $15,247, while out-of-state students pay around $46,024. Additional costs include fees, textbooks, supplies, housing, and personal expenses.

Estimating Student Debt

While median student debt data for UC Davis’s chemical engineering graduates is not available, students should plan their borrowing carefully. Assuming federal loans are used, a typical undergraduate debt might range from $20,000 to $40,000, depending on borrowing behavior and financial aid packages.

Return on Investment (ROI)

The high earning potential and strong job prospects for chemical engineers suggest a favorable ROI. Despite initial debt, graduates often recover their investment within a few years post-graduation through competitive salaries. However, prudent borrowing and timely repayment are essential to maximize financial benefits.
